高性价比
国外便宜VPS服务器推荐

Java与C#哪个更适配物联网开发

在物联网IoT快速发展的今天,选择合适的编程语言对于项目的成功至关重要。Java和C#作为两种广泛使用的编程语言,在物联网开发中各有优势。本文将从产品优势、应用场景和服务特色三个方面,深入分析Java和C#在物联网领域的适用性。

1. Java的优势与适用场景

Java以其跨平台特性、丰富的库支持以及成熟的生态系统,在物联网开发中占据重要地位。Java的JVMJava虚拟机能够运行在多种设备上,无论是嵌入式系统还是云服务器,都能保持良好的兼容性。此外,Java拥有大量的开源框架和工具,如Eclipse IoT、Apache Kafka等,为物联网应用的开发提供了强大的支持。

在实际应用中,Java常用于构建大规模的物联网系统,例如智能城市、工业自动化和远程监控系统。其稳定性高、安全性强的特点,使其成为企业级物联网项目中的首选语言之一。同时,Java在处理大量数据流时表现出色,适合需要高性能和可扩展性的场景。

Java还具备良好的社区支持和文档资源,开发者可以轻松找到相关的教程、论坛和技术资料。这种便利性大大降低了学习和开发的门槛,使得Java成为许多物联网开发者的首选。

2. C#的优势与适用场景

C#是由微软推出的现代编程语言,结合了C++的强大功能和Java的简洁性,具有出色的性能和灵活性。C#在Windows平台上的表现尤为出色,特别是在与.NET框架集成后,能够提供高效的开发体验。对于需要与Windows系统深度整合的物联网项目,C#是一个理想的选择。

在物联网领域,C#常用于智能家居、工业控制和边缘计算等场景。由于其对硬件的直接访问能力,C#特别适合开发需要实时响应和低延迟的应用程序。此外,C#还支持多种开发工具和平台,如Visual Studio、Unity等,为开发者提供了丰富的开发环境。

随着物联网技术的发展,C#也在不断演进,新增了许多适用于物联网的功能和优化。例如,.NET Core的跨平台特性使得C#不仅限于Windows系统,还可以在Linux和macOS上运行,进一步拓宽了其应用范围。

3. 服务特色与技术支持

无论是Java还是C#,在物联网开发过程中都需要专业的技术支持和服务。一万网络为用户提供全面的技术支持,包括代码调试、性能优化和系统部署等服务。我们的工程师团队拥有丰富的物联网开发经验,能够根据客户需求提供定制化的解决方案。

在服务方面,一万网络注重客户体验,提供7×24小时在线支持,确保用户在开发过程中遇到问题时能够及时得到帮助。此外,我们还提供详细的文档和教程,帮助用户快速上手并掌握相关技术。

对于希望提升项目效率和质量的客户,一万网络还提供一站式开发服务,涵盖从需求分析到系统上线的全过程。通过我们的专业服务,用户可以专注于业务逻辑的实现,而无需担心技术细节。

4. 选择建议与总结

综合来看,Java和C#在物联网开发中各有千秋。Java更适合需要跨平台支持和大规模数据处理的项目,而C#则在Windows平台和实时性要求高的场景中表现出色。选择哪种语言,应根据具体的应用需求、开发团队的技术背景以及项目目标来决定。

无论选择Java还是C#,一万网络都能为用户提供全方位的支持和服务。我们致力于帮助客户打造高效、稳定和可扩展的物联网解决方案,助力企业在数字化转型中取得成功。

如果您正在考虑物联网项目的开发,欢迎联系一万网络,获取更多详细信息或安排咨询。我们的专业团队将为您量身定制最佳方案,助您实现项目目标。

未经允许不得转载:一万网络 » Java与C#哪个更适配物联网开发